What Is a Powder Shot?

UM powder shot refers to a discrete, controlled discharge of powdered material—typically metal, cerâmica, polymer, or composite particles—in manufacturing, industrial, or experimental processes. Unlike liquid or molten feeds, powder shots leverage the unique properties of solid particulates, such as flowability, reatividade, or thermal insulation, to achieve specific outcomes. This technique is pivotal in fields ranging from additive manufacturing and powder metallurgy to pharmaceuticals and pyrotechnics. Below, we explore its mechanisms, Aplicações, and implications.

1. Key Mechanisms Behind Powder Shots

  • Discharge Control:
    Powder shots are often delivered via precision devices (Por exemplo, powder feeders, dosing systems, or pneumatic conveyors) that regulate volume, velocity, and dispersion. Parameters like particle size distribution, cohesion, and humidity critically influence flow consistency.
  • Energy Integration:
    Em alguns processos (Por exemplo, thermal spraying or laser-based additive manufacturing), powder shots are combined with external energy sources (Por exemplo, plasma, lasers, or flames) to induce melting, sintering, or chemical reactions upon impact with a substrate or target area.
  • Cohesion vs. Dispersion:
    Fine powders (<50 μm) may exhibit electrostatic or van der Waals forces, requiring vibratory feeders, carrier gases, or fluidizing agents to prevent clumping and ensure uniform shot dispersion.

2. Core Applications of Powder Shots

  • Additive Manufacturing (AM):
    Em Powder Bed Fusion (PBF) processes like Selective Laser Sintering (SLS) or Electron Beam Melting (EBM), thin layers of metal/polymer powder are deposited, and a powder shot is selectively fused by energy beams to build 3D objects layer by layer. The precision of powder shots directly impacts surface finish and part density.
  • Thermal Spray Coatings:
    High-velocity powder shots (Por exemplo, metal, cerâmica, ou carboneto) are propelled onto substrates using plasma, combustion flames, or HVOF (High-Velocity Oxygen Fuel) systems to form wear-resistant, corrosion-protective, or thermally insulating coatings for engines, turbines, or medical implants.
  • Pharmaceuticals:
    In dry powder inhalers (DPIs), metered powder shots of drug formulations are aerosolized for targeted lung delivery. Particle morphology (Por exemplo, spherical vs. needle-like) and shot consistency affect drug bioavailability and patient compliance.
  • Pyrotechnics & Energetics:
    Explosive or propellant powder shots are used in safety systems (Por exemplo, airbag initiators), fireworks, or aerospace thrusters, where controlled combustion rates and energy release are critical.
  • Powder Metallurgy (PM):
    Powder shots are compacted into "green parts" via pressing or injection molding before sintering, enabling the production of high-strength, near-net-shape components (Por exemplo, engrenagens, filtros) with minimal material waste.

3. Technical Challenges & Innovations

  • Flow Instability:
    Irregular powder shots (Por exemplo, inconsistent density, bridging in hoppers) disrupt processes like 3D printing. Solutions include particle surface treatments (Por exemplo, silanization) or real-time flow monitoring via sensors.
  • Waste & Recycling:
    Excess powder in AM or PM processes often requires recovery and sieving. Advances in closed-loop systems (Por exemplo, unfused powder reclamation in SLS) reduce material costs and environmental footprints.
  • Hybridization:
    Combining powder shots with other techniques—such as directed energy deposition (DED) for large-scale metal AM or binder jetting for multimaterial structures—expands design possibilities.
